The snowblower engine cradle assembly, part number 722304, provides a stable mounting platform for the engine and helps align it with the drivetrain and frame. Proper support reduces vibration and helps maintain consistent belt and pulley alignment during operation.
If the engine vibrates excessively, feels loose at its mounting points, or you hear rattling or knocking near the engine area during use, the engine cradle assembly may be worn, bent, or misaligned. Belt tracking issues, uneven drive engagement, or premature wear on connected parts can also result from inadequate engine support.
Disconnect the spark plug wire before beginning the repair. This assembly installs near heavy engine components and metal edges, so work gloves can help protect your hands during removal and installation. Make sure the engine cradle sits flush with the frame and that the engine is aligned before reconnecting the spark plug wire.
